Abstract
This experiment examined the effects of diet on anxiety in 97 (aged) male Sprague-Dawley rats. Rats were assigned to three dietary groups (high-fat, high-sucrose, and standard chow) then assessed at three time intervals (baseline, day 21, and day 42). Contrary to prediction, there were no significant main effects or interactions.
